特辑 存储器的一些基础问题
1.存储器(存储芯片)的容量大小与地址线和数据线的关系
存储器的容量大小就是存储单元的数量,地址线一次确定一个存储单元,
存储单元的个数=2^n个地址线条数;地址线上,值可能取得所有组合确定了存储单元的个数;

RAM芯片存储容量=2^n个地址线条数*数据线条数=存储单元的个数 * 存储字长;
所以这就是他们之间的关系,需要搞清楚!
2.存储器扩展中的字扩展和位扩展分别是指什么?什么时候需要哪一种扩展?
字扩展:扩展存储字的数量;
位扩展:扩展存储字长的数量;
需要字扩展:所需要的存储器的字长满足要求,但是存储单元数不满足要求;
需要位扩展:所需要的存储器存储单元满足要求,但是存储字长不满足要求;
3.存储器和字块、存储单元(存储字)、字长的关系
在这里给大家先简单说一下,他们之间的关系是什么样的。
存储器一个芯片里面会有很多字块,字块里面又会有很多存储单元也就是我们所说的字(word),那么每个字里面又会有很多bit(因为字就是有若干个字节组成的)。

大家不清楚这几个单位可以看下面的这些概念:
位:计算机能处理的最小单元,它不随CPU的处理能力的变化而变化
字节:就是8位数据的大小,它也不随CPU的处理能力的变化而变化
字:计算机进行数据处理时,一次存取、加工和传送的数据长度称为字(word),一个字通常由一个或多个字节(一般是字节的整数倍)构成。
字长:计算机的每个字所包含的的位数称为字长。一般我们说的8位机、16位机、32位机、64位机指的就是计算机的字长
存储元:我们所说的存储元就是由一个电容和MOS管形成的一个电路,如下图所示:

存储单元(存储字):

我们的存储字长也可以是16bit、32bit都是可以变化的;我们可以看存储字长就是我们的存储字的位数;

在这里我们需要注意的是字节和存储字的区别;

根据上图这样看的话我们也就不难理解为什么地址线能够确定存储单元的个数了(很明显),那么后面乘以多少位便可以说成数据线的位数。大家仔细品一下。
我给大家画了一个图片来说明我们3这个题目的关系,因为计算机组成原理(唐朔飞版)书上的存储单元指的是编址单位:

4.存储器存储中,我们应该先进行什么扩展,是位扩展还是字扩展?
先进行位扩展,形成满足位要求的存储芯片组;再使用存储芯片组进行字扩展,也就是先变宽,再变长。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容,请联系我们,一经查实,本站将立刻删除。
如需转载请保留出处:https://51itzy.com/kjqy/51809.html